Lap Belt Installation
Install with the lap belt as shown above.
Before You Begin:
Check that your vehicle belt is compatible for use with child
seats. See pages 6 – 8 for more information.
Remove the Versa-Tether from the pouch and place it up and
over the child seat back.
* Britax recommends that the Versa-Tether is used at all times.
Using the tether will improve the stability of the child seat and
reduce the risk of injury. Check your vehicle owner’s manual for
tether anchor locations. Only attach the Versa-Tether to anchor
points designated to the chosen seating position as indicated by
your vehicle owner’s manual.
Adjust this child seat to position 1 or 2 and place forward-facing
on the vehicle seat (see page 15).
* Ensure that no more than 20% or 3 in. (7.6 cm) of the base hangs
over the edge of the vehicle seat.
WARNING!
• Your child seat may not perform as intended if the base of the child
seat is not flat on the vehicle seat.
• Some vehicle head restraints may obstruct
the harness adjuster from reaching the
highest position. If this is the case, you may
need to raise or remove the vehicle head
restraint. DO NOT force the child seat head
restraint past the vehicle head restraint.
Doing so could cause the child seat not to
perform as intended.
1 Loosen the harness.
a Lift harness adjuster lever
b Pull both harness straps forward
2 Remove the body pillow and
unbuckle the harness.
3 Pull the head pad up, then pull
the seat cover forward to access
the forward-facing belt path.
5 Push down on the middle of the
the child seat while pulling the
vehicle belt to remove all slack.
6 Attach the Versa-Tether to a
designated anchor (see vehicle
owner’s manual) and remove
slack (see pages 17 19).
7 Store the excess webbing in the
elastic strap.
8 Replace the cover.
4 Route the vehicle seat belt
through the forward-facing belt
slots, then buckle. Ensure the
vehicle belt is not twisted.
Checklist
9 Check that the vehicle belt is securely fastened.
9 Check that no more than 20% or 3 in. (7.6 cm) of the base hangs over
the edge of the vehicle seat.
9 Check that the child seat cannot be moved front to back or side to side
more than 1 in. (2.5 cm) at the belt path. If the child seat is not secure,
repeat installation or use a different seating location.
9 Check that any excess Versa-Tether
®
webbing is contained within your
vehicle and secured in the elastic strap.
IMPORTANT:
DO NOT use lock-offs for lap belt installations.
